The Power of Reflection and Height

The most effective visual illusion in small-space design relies on manipulating light and drawing the eye upwards. These items are indispensable for making a room feel twice its size without moving any walls. A large mirror is arguably the single most impactful item, creating the illusion of depth and space by reflecting light and the room itself. Furthermore, when floor space is scarce, the only direction to go is up. Floating shelves are perfect for utilising vertical wall space that is often wasted, acting as functional storage and an aesthetic display area without cluttering the floor. These strategies are cornerstones of the best decor ideas for small room maximisation.

Clutter Control and Multitasking Essentials

A small room quickly feels claustrophobic when cluttered. This set of must-have decor items focuses on seamless organisation and dual-functionality, ensuring every item pulls its weight. In a compact space, every piece of furniture should be multi-functional. A storage ottoman acts as a coffee table, extra seating, and a hidden storage bin. 

Additionally, furniture with tall, exposed legs minimises visual weight, making the overall room appear less congested and more open. Finally, attractive decorative baskets and bins turn everyday mess into stylish decor, maintaining a tidy, streamlined look essential for effective small home decor items.

    Curtains are not just for privacy; they are a critical element in small room architecture. The biggest hack is to hang your curtain rod high and wide. Install the rod as close to the ceiling as possible (often 6-12 inches above the window frame) and extend it several inches beyond the window’s width.

    This draws the eye upward, making the ceiling look dramatically taller and the window larger. Choose sheer or light, neutral-coloured, floor-length curtains that allow natural light to filter in, further enhancing the bright, airy feel.     Contrary to intuition, a rug that is too small will make your small room look smaller by visually chopping up the floor. Choose an oversized rug that is large enough to sit under the front legs of all your main furniture pieces. This grounds the seating area, creates a cohesive zone (especially important in open-plan spaces), and makes the room feel unified and expansive rather than fragmented.

  • What are the best colours to make a small room look bigger?
    +
    Opt for light, neutral colours like white, cream, soft grey, or pale pastels, as they reflect light and make the walls appear to recede, creating a greater sense of space.
  • Should I use small or large furniture in a small room?
    +
    Focus on fewer, but appropriately scaled pieces. Avoid too many small items (which cause clutter). Instead, choose multifunctional pieces (like storage beds) and have exposed legs to maximise floor visibility.
  • How can I add storage without a big closet?
    +
    Utilise vertical space with floating shelves and invest in furniture with hidden storage, such as storage ottomans, bed frames with drawers, and floor-to-ceiling modular wardrobes.
  • Is it better to hang curtains high or low in a small room?
    +
    Always hang curtains high and wide. Install the rod close to the ceiling and extend it past the window frame to make the windows look larger and draw the eye up, increasing the perceived height of the room.
  • How do I avoid clutter when decorating a small space?
    +
    Be selective: adhere to the "less is more" principle, only display items you genuinely love, and commit to using decorative storage baskets and furniture with concealed compartments to keep surfaces clear.
